Top 5 Signs It’s Time for a Roof Inspection

Your roof is your home’s first line of defense against the elements, and regular inspections are crucial to ensuring its longevity and functionality. However, knowing when it’s time for a roof inspection can sometimes be challenging. Here are the top five signs that should prompt you to schedule a thorough examination by professionals.

1. Visible Damage or Aging: If you notice visible signs of wear and tear such as cracked or missing shingles, granule loss, or general aging, it’s a clear indication that your roof requires attention. These visible cues often suggest that the protective layer of your roof is compromised, making it susceptible to leaks and further damage.

2. Water Stains on Ceilings: Water stains on your ceilings or walls inside your home are a red flag that there may be a leak in your roof. Leaks can lead to extensive damage if not addressed promptly. A roof inspection is essential to identify the source of the leak and prevent any further deterioration of your home’s interior.

3. Sagging or Uneven Roof Surface: A visibly sagging or uneven roofline is a serious concern that necessitates immediate attention. It could be indicative of structural issues or even water damage beneath the surface. A professional roof inspection will help determine the cause and extent of the problem, allowing for timely repairs.

4. Increased Energy Bills: Unexpected spikes in your energy bills could be linked to a compromised roof. If your roof is not adequately insulated or if there are gaps and leaks, your heating or cooling systems may be working overtime. A roof inspection can reveal areas that need improvement, helping you enhance energy efficiency.

5. Moss or Algae Growth: The presence of moss, algae, or mold on your roof not only affects its aesthetic appeal but can also lead to deterioration of roofing materials. These organisms can trap moisture, causing decay and rot. A roof inspection will determine the extent of the growth and guide appropriate measures to safeguard your roof’s integrity.
